FRONTIER MARKETS
The term frontier markets is commonly used to describe the equity markets of the smaller and less accessible, but still "investable", countries of the developing world. The frontier, or pre-emerging equity markets, are typically pursued by investors seeking high, long-run return potential as well as low correlations with other markets. The implication of a country being labeled as frontier, or pre-emerging, is that the market will begin to develop.
